The center difference in plain terms

Trimming shapes and decreases foliage, usually for immediate look or clearance. Think of it as cosmetic aid or tidy edges. Pruning courses layout and health with the aid of elimination exceptional branches at specific facets so the tree grows more potent over time. Good pruning uses the tree’s biology on your advantage. It respects branch collars, anticipates load distribution, and assists in keeping the tree’s usual structure intact.

Both use saws and either eliminate inexperienced improvement, however the decision criteria are the different. When I trim, I’m answering “How much do I desire to take off to fulfill this line clearance or view requirement?” When I prune, I’m asking “Which cuts will minimize risk, avoid rubbing, and hooked up reliable scaffold branches five years from now?”

How trees reply, and why your cuts matter

Trees compartmentalize wounds instead of heal them like animal tissue. When you make a cut, the tree isolates the injured edge at the back of walls of recent tissue and chemistry. That strategy works preferrred whilst the minimize is just outside the department collar, leaves the department bark ridge intact, and doesn’t rip bark. Trim with indiscriminate shearing or flush cuts and also you create long stubs or All About Trees tree care super surface parts that close slowly, inviting moisture and rot fungi.

A tree also balances its cover with its roots. Remove an excessive amount of foliage in a single go and you disrupt that steadiness. The elementary response is a surge of epicormic shoots - skinny, rapid increase accomplishing for pale. These shoots are weakly attached and ruin in storms. Over trimming junipers, laurels, or maples is a short route to a furry mess in a yr’s time. Pruning, by using contrast, respects the guideline of thirds. On pressured or mature timber, I stay away from taking greater than about 15 to twenty % of dwell crown in a season, and I unfold structural paintings over a number of years.

Where trimming suits: appearances, clearance, and pursuits containment

There is nothing inherently wrong with trimming while it’s executed with restraint. On selected species and in certain contexts, it’s the top circulate.

  • For hedges, screens, and tightly clumping shrubs, trimming holds a line and assists in keeping increase in bounds. Privet, boxwood, and photinia tolerate shearing and bounce back with out structural penalty.
  • Around walkways and driveways, trimming a handful of extending department tips improves clearance devoid of overhauling the entire tree.
  • Under utility strains or roof eaves, trimming can swiftly limit conflicts. I still want selective reduction cuts over uniform shearing, but in some cases get entry to and finances factor to a cautious trim.

If I trim a broadleaf tree, I do it with discount cuts back to laterals, now not shears. That preserves normal shape even as shortening reach. The greater you eradicate out at the advice with no regard for a lateral, the greater energetic and unstable the regrowth could be.

Where pruning suits: construction, safeguard, and longevity

Pruning is the craft aspect of the paintings. It’s diagnostic and deliberate. Before I prune, I walk the tree and learn its tale: the place the prevailing winds hit, which branches rub, where sunlight gaps motivate heavy boom, and how the trunk tapers. Pruning makes the such a lot change when:

  • You prefer fewer typhoon screw ups. Removing deadwood, crossing branches, and weak co-dominant stems reduces leverage and features of friction.
  • You would like more suitable fruit and plants. Thinning cuts expand gentle and air inside the canopy, which reduces disease and improves fruit dimension and colour in apples, pears, and peaches.
  • You desire to set a young tree on a mighty trail. A few effectively located cuts in years 2 to five build a sturdy scaffold and remove future risks.

In follow, pruning pivots round 3 cuts: thinning, aid, and removing. Thinning cuts take a complete department again to its origin, starting the canopy. Reduction cuts shorten a branch by means of reducing lower back to a lateral that is at least a 3rd the diameter of the determine. Removal cuts take out a defective or poorly located department entirely. Done in fact, these cuts depart the department collar intact and give the tree a accurate possibility to seal.

Timing isn't always just a calendar note

I see a great deal of calendars with blanket advice like prune in iciness or trim in summer season. Those ideas are too blunt. Timing rides on species, weather, and the objective.

Dormant season pruning, past due wintry weather in many areas, reduces sap stream and minimizes infirmity unfold in species at risk of bleeding. It additionally affords a transparent view of architecture. Structural alterations in okay, elms, and maples ordinarily healthy this window. The tradeoff is that dormant pruning can stimulate vigorous spring improvement, that is positive should you’re constructing format and unhelpful while you’re attempting to gradual a tree down.

Summer pruning and faded trimming can curb increase via removal leaves whilst the tree is actively photosynthesizing. If a maple overshadows a backyard bed, a mid season discount can let in solar devoid of frightening the equal flush you’d get from a past due winter lower. For cherries and plums vulnerable to silver leaf and canker, dry summer cuts slash an infection menace. Conversely, forestall heavy summer paintings in heat waves; it stresses the tree and raises water demand.

Avoid pruning right through moist spells for species liable to ailments that trip moisture and fresh wounds. Oak wilt threat varies domestically, but the effortless education is to circumvent pruning alright in the course of lively beetle flight classes which may run from spring into mid summer. When in doubt, payment local extension advisories.

Species count more than many think

Pruning a beech seriously is not just like pruning a crape myrtle or a pine. Pay interest to picket anatomy, boom addiction, and ailment hazards.

Oaks decide upon minimal, properly regarded as cuts. Their slower compartmentalization makes refreshing method indispensable. I’d especially make just a few considerate rate reductions than many small nips.

Birches and maples bleed sap in late wintry weather if minimize close to bud holiday. Bleeding is primarily cosmetic, however for those who wish to circumvent it, wait except leaves are fully out.

Stone fruit advantage from annual pruning that removes inward expansion and improves air circulation. Peach timber bears fruit on remaining year’s shoots, so renewal pruning is prime to preserve younger fruiting wood coming.

Conifers don’t reply to difficult back cuts the means broadleaf bushes do. On pines, you possibly can pinch candles to take care of size, yet slicing returned into historic picket that lacks needles gained’t regenerate. On arborvitae, that you may trim flippantly on efficient guidelines, however chopping to come back into naked internal stems gained’t produce new foliage.

Mature timber with decay wallet, lifeless tops, or lightning scars require restraint. I incessantly counsel staged work over two or 3 seasons, specifically if the tree is successful. Taking too much reside tissue rapidly can tip a marginal tree toward decline.

Safety and menace: the place trimming turns into a liability

I have grew to become down work when the request was once “take as a whole lot as you will to make it small.” Over reduction, oftentimes called lion’s tailing while interior branches are stripped and all foliage is left on ends, creates whips that snap overdue in storms. Topping - slicing returned to stubs without laterals - is worse. It is immediate, that's low-cost, and it creates a upkeep catch with weakly hooked up clusters of sprouts. Municipalities sometimes nevertheless require topping underneath prime strains by means of clearance mandates, yet for exclusive trees, it’s a ultimate inn in any case other treatments fail.

On the flip facet, now not touching a tree might possibly be its own possibility. Deadwood over a patio, cracked limbs with blanketed bark, and branches rubbing shingles are preventable concerns. Pruning enables you to diminish hazard with no compromising the tree’s long run. A remarkable rule: if you happen to desire to get rid of more than 1 / 4 of the live crown on a mature tree to fulfill your pursuits, step lower back and re-examine. There can be more suitable suggestions like specific rate reductions, selective removals of competing limbs, or maybe planting a secondary tree to take over the role so that you can steadily decrease the first.

Homeowner errors I see over and over

Shearing a tree as though it had been a hedge is the pinnacle mistake. The moment is cutting too on the brink of the trunk, getting rid of the department collar. Those flush cuts seem to be neat at the beginning, but they slow closure and invite decay. Third is ladder paintings with out tie in issues. Every year, I hear about falls from aluminum ladders into reside branches with a observed in hand. If you could possibly’t succeed in it effectively with the two toes planted and a sharp hand saw, appoint individual who can climb or deliver a lift.

Another customary misstep is cleansing out the inner and leaving foliage simplest at the ideas. It appears to be like airy inside the brief term and appears like you “lightened” the tree, yet you have got expanded leverage and wind sail at the very ends, which increases the chance of breakage.

Finally, reducing at the incorrect time for the species is accepted. For example, heavy overdue summer cuts on a sugar maple formerly a drought stretch can cause facet browning and rigidity that contains into winter. The bigger go is to watch for a cool, solid length or push structural adjustments to dormancy if affliction risk is low.

Tools, methodology, and refreshing work

Sharp gear substitute everything. A accurate sharpened hand observed cuts turbo and cleaner than a boring chainsaw run by way of a anxious arm at complete extension. For maximum residential pruning below 4 inches in diameter, a hand saw and pass pruners are the good equipment. Use a three minimize strategy on larger branches to preclude bark tearing: an undercut a brief distance from the trunk, a top cut out of doors that to drop the weight, then a closing clear cut simply open air the department collar.

Disinfecting methods between timber is a basic habit that issues when hearth blight or different pathogens are in play. A spray bottle with 70 p.c. isopropyl alcohol does the task. It’s no longer important on each and every lower, however it's far prudent whilst relocating among trees of the comparable vulnerable species all through an epidemic.

Make cuts that recognize taper and load paths. If you are reducing an extended lateral, make a selection a potent subordinate department that is at least a third the diameter of the dad or mum. Take care not to leave stubs, which die returned and feed decay.

Setting a wise repairs rhythm

Trees do not want per month grooming. They wish a clean structure early, periodic assessments, and exact paintings. A rhythm I use on many websites:

  • Years 1 to five after planting: determine a dominant leader, house scaffold branches, get rid of or cut down co-dominant stems early, and properly crossing limbs. One faded prune every 1 to 2 years.
  • Years 6 to fifteen: determine each 2 to a few years for clearance necessities, deadwood, and steadiness. Make modest discount rates where limbs outrun the cover.
  • Mature segment: check out each and every 3 to five years, with greater regular exams after noticeable storms. Focus on deadwood, chance aid, and delicate structural transformations. Avoid enormous stay crown removals unless there is a transparent safe practices motive.

For hedges and formal displays, trimming intervals can be tighter, oftentimes two to four instances in line with growing to be season relying on species and vigour. Keep hedges moderately wider at the bottom than the proper so shrink foliage gets gentle. That one aspect retains hedges crammed and reduces woody gaps.
